Description
1. Compliant with ISO 6432 standard (for sizes 8-25);
2. Integrated fixed cushion rings on front/rear end caps reduce impact shock during directional changes;
3. Multiple rear cap configurations simplify installation flexibility;
4. Riveted hybrid enclosure structure securely joins end caps to stainless steel cylinder barrel;
5. Stainless steel piston rod and barrel construction ensures reliable operation in mildly corrosive environments;
6. Comprehensive cylinder specifications and mounting accessories available for customized solutions.

This dual-rod mini cylinder features integrated air cushions and symmetrical force output, engineered for precision linear motion in space-constrained automation. The twin-rod design eliminates rotational torque during operation, making it ideal for alignment-critical applications. Optimized for 500,000+ cycle durability with <0.5mm cushion dead zone.

Industrial Applications:
  • PCB handling robots - chip placement & testing
  • Medical device assembly - syringe plunger actuation
  • Semiconductor wafer processing - vacuum chuck positioning
  • Packaging lines - simultaneous lid closing mechanisms
  • Textile machinery - precision thread tension control
Installation protocol: Maintain 0.5mm minimum lateral clearance between rods and load. For vertical mounting, use locking nuts on both piston rod ends. Buffer adjustment requires 0.5Nm torque limit - turn clockwise to decrease cushioning effect.
